Wednesday Nights @ Zion!!!

for Fun, Faith, Fellowship and Food! ! Dinner is served from 5:45 p.m. to 6:30 p.m. (Please make reservations on the “gold” form provided in our Sunday church bulletins; complete the form and drop it in the collection plate. OR, call or e-mail the church office by noon on Tuesday before the Wednesday meal.) Meals are $3.00 for adults (ages 11 and up); $2.00 for children ages 3-10; free for children under age 3. Activities for all ages begin at 6:30 p.m.

Sunday Nite LIVE!

Sunday Nite LIVE!

Every Sunday at 6:30 p.m.

Zion Family Life Center Gymnasium

Join us in the Family Life Center every Sunday at 6:30 p.m., for a different kind of worship service! This is a contextual worship service based on the style of worship that Martin Luther encouraged–music and language easily sung and understood by everyone. Members of Zion’s congregation and guest musicians will accompany the singing with acoustic instruments, and our liturgy will be easy to follow. Come with us to journey back to the “roots of Lutheranism!”
